Hello, i added a simple enhancement to make CompilerMethodTrailer to be more friendly with CompiledMethod subclasses. It provides an additional method #createMethod:header:methodClass: which allows to create a compiled method with other class, than a CompiledMethod. Installing it requires 2 separate phases: phase1 - adds #createMethod:header:methodClass: method phase2 - puts this method in use. if you merge these changesets, you'd will run into a problem, because filein/fileout utility does not honors the order of changes, how they should be applied. Just to make a little note. I'm adapting the lightweight classes package to work with CompilerMethodTrailer. In this method
CompiledMethodTrailer>>createMethod: numberOfBytesForAllButTrailer header: headerWord     | meth |     encodedData ifNil: [ self encode ].     meth := CompiledMethod newMethod: numberOfBytesForAllButTrailer + size header: headerWord.     ...
I need to answer a different kind of CompiledMethod, it would be nice if my own CompiledMethod class could be specified in some way to make the CompiledMethodTrailer more flexible.
Yes, you could add a class parameter, so method will take 3
createMethod: numberOfBytesForAllButTrailer header: headerWord class: aMethodClass
